Far too many programs are asking to change your browser homepage to their homepage when you install a program. and it's starting to get to the point where programs don't even ask before they change your homepage. How can I prevent anything but me from changing my homepage (i.e. Websites, installation programs, etc.)?

You can try to set the home page via a setting in the file user.js in the Firefox Profile Folder. Firefox reads that file on every start, so if extensions or other programs make changes to prefs.js then you can override them. You can make that file read-only to protect it more. You can copy the line with browser.startup.homepage from prefs.js to the user.js file.

  • Help > Troubleshooting Information > Profile Directory: Open Containing Folder
